Why Ireland?

Ireland — Europe's Silicon Valley for Indian Tech Graduates

🏢
Tech Giant Headquarters

Google, Apple, Meta, Microsoft, Amazon, and Salesforce all have their European HQs in Dublin. For CS and business graduates, Ireland offers unparalleled access to top employers.

📋
Graduate Stay Permission

Level 9 (Master's) graduates get a 2-year stay-back. Level 8 (Bachelor's) graduates get 1 year. Allows you to find a job and transition to a work permit.

🇪🇺
EU Membership Benefits

An Irish degree and work experience opens doors across all 27 EU countries. Critical Skill Employment Permit leads to Irish PR and eventual citizenship.

🗣️
English-Speaking Country

Ireland is the only native English-speaking country in the EU post-Brexit. No language barrier for Indian students — easier adaptation and career growth.

🎓
Quality Education

Trinity College Dublin and UCD are in the QS top 200. Strong programs in Computer Science, Pharmaceutical Sciences, Business, and Data Analytics.

💼
Strong Job Market

Ireland's unemployment rate is below 5%. High demand for tech, pharma, finance, and data science professionals. Average graduate salary €35,000–€55,000/year.

Key Facts

Ireland Student Visa & Requirements

Student Visa (Stamp 2): Apply through AVATS online. Processing 2–4 weeks. Valid for course duration + a few weeks.
Tuition: €10,000–€25,000/year depending on university and course
Living Costs: €12,000–€15,000/year (Dublin is more expensive — €1,200–€1,500/month)
Work Rights: 20 hours/week during term, 40 hours/week during holidays (Jun–Sep and Dec–Jan)
English Requirement: IELTS 6.0–6.5 overall for most universities
Top Universities: Trinity College Dublin (QS #98), UCD, UCC, DCU, NUI Galway
